1. Choose the Right Design

The design of your invitation is crucial as it reflects the overall theme and atmosphere of your party. Consider the following factors when selecting a design:* Theme: Do you have a specific theme for your party? If so, choose a design that aligns with the theme.
* Color scheme: The colors you choose should complement the overall decor and atmosphere of your party.
* Font style: The font you use should be easy to read and reflect the tone of the party, whether it's elegant, playful, or anything in between.
* Graphics: Use graphics sparingly to add a touch of visual interest without overwhelming the invitation.

2. Craft a Clear and Concise Message

Your invitation should clearly state the following information:* Who: The honoree being celebrated.
* What: The type of event (e.g., birthday party, celebration).
* When: Date and time of the event.
* Where: The location of the event, including address and directions if necessary.
* RSVP: Include an RSVP method (e.g., email, phone number).

3. Personalize It

Make your invitations truly special by personalizing them for each guest. Consider adding a personal touch, such as:* Handwritten note: Write a personalized message to each guest on the invitation.
* Custom photo: Include a photo of the honoree or a group photo with the guest.
* Name drop: Mention something specific about the guest that shows you care, such as a hobby or interest.
* Special request: If applicable, indicate any special requests, such as dress code or dietary restrictions.

4. Choose the Right Paper

The paper you choose for your invitations can make a big difference in the overall look and feel. Consider the following:* Texture: Choose paper with a texture that complements the design of your invitation.
* Color: White or cream paper is a classic choice, but you can also choose colored paper to match your theme.
* Weight: The weight of the paper will affect the durability and quality of your invitations. Opt for thicker paper for a more substantial feel.

5. Consider Digital Invitations

Digital invitations are a convenient and eco-friendly alternative to traditional paper invitations. They are easy to send and track, and they offer a wider range of design options. However, they may not be suitable for formal or traditional events where physical invitations are preferred.

6. Include a Gift Registry (Optional)

If you have a gift registry, include the information on the invitation. This will make it easy for guests to find and choose gifts that you'll love.

7. Proofread Carefully

Before sending out your invitations, proofread them carefully for any errors in spelling, grammar, or formatting. You don't want any embarrassing mistakes on your special day!

Sample Birthday Invitation TemplateFront
Name of honoree: [Honoree's name]
Type of event: [Type of party]
Date and time: [Date] at [Time]
Location: [Address]
RSVP: [Email or phone number]
Inside
Personalized message:
Dear [Guest name],
I'm beyond excited to invite you to my [age]th birthday party! I'm celebrating with a [theme] party at [location] on [date] at [time].
Please RSVP by [date] so we can get a headcount.
I can't wait to celebrate with you all!
Love,
[Honoree's name]
Additional Tips
* Set a budget: Determine how much you're willing to spend on invitations before you start designing them.
* Use online tools: There are many online tools available that can help you design and create invitations.
* Get feedback: Ask friends or family members for feedback on your invitation design before sending them out.
* Send invitations early: Give guests ample time to save the date and make arrangements to attend.
* Consider thank-you notes: Send out thank-you notes after the party to express your gratitude to your guests for celebrating with you.
